Understand Your Nature

962.6Comment: Kabbalah says that the universal law of nature deliberately spoils man’s life in order to force him to correct his relations with others.

My response: Of course. This eternal, wise law, full of bestowal and love, affects us in such a way that it makes our egoistic life, which is the opposite of it, unbearable in order to shake us thoroughly so we would see that we have nowhere to go.

We need to survive, somehow exist, and feed ourselves because we will soon not be able to breathe in this world. What do we do? It turns out that we will inevitably have to correct ourselves.

Question: On one hand, we must correct our attitude toward others. On the other hand, we say that doing charity work is bad. What should be changed then? After all, everyone thinks that he treats others very well and helps others in everything.

Answer: Nothing needs to be changed. You just need to understand your nature.

We must study ourselves and the world in which we exist—not our world but the upper world— the entire universe in which we are. We must understand it, rise to the level of the Creator, that is, to the level of the single law, feel it, and change ourselves to match it. And then we will really become creatures of the upper world.

Kabbalah explains how to do this.

Nature Is One

709Question: Any system known to us goes through four phases of development: birth, flourishing, withering, and death. Now we are at the beginning of the creation of the spiritual foundations of management based on the principles of Kabbalah. Is it possible to create some prerequisites or foundations for another system of development? Or is it a law of nature that we cannot escape?

Answer: The fact is that an integral system of complete interconnection, including people, mind, feelings, absolutely everything, exists in nature at the inanimate, vegetative, animate, and human degrees.

However, in relation to humans, we do not perceive nature as integral, eternal, infinite, and perfect because we perceive it in our egoistic sensory organs. Therefore, we see our world as disconnected and distant, and we judge everything that happens through our egoistic qualities.

As soon as we begin to connect, we will reveal nature in its true integral form, and it will appear to us in a completely different way. To the extent that we correct ourselves, we will also see nature corrected. But we do not need to correct it, we will simply discover it for ourselves corrected in our senses. After all, our states are absolutely subjective.

The only thing we need to change is the perception of reality, the perception of a person, and then we will see that outside of us nature is absolutely integral.

In fact, it is one! There is no need to divide it into different sciences and different approaches. We distinguish stages and formations in it only relatively to our limited understanding.

Why Do Good Intentions Not Lead To Anything Good?

273.02Comment: It has been said that a Kabbalist can make corrections to the world with his thoughts and desires and can have a positive impact on the general universe. And the rest of the people who do not understand only destroy everything with their good deeds and charity.

It is strange enough for a person to hear that the road to hell is paved with good intentions.

My Response: Do we really not see that all these good intentions and impulses do not lead to anything good?

In principle, any of the actions we perform while uncorrected, no matter how beautiful, noble, with understanding, with love, giving to others, they seem, they are still selfish, they still imply some kind of benefit for ourselves.

Despite the fact that everything looks very positive from the outside: people go to hospitals, help the sick, pensioners, donate a lot of money to charity, fight for cleanliness, for the environment, even give their lives for their homeland, such actions do not lead to a better world.

The question is: Does our world deteriorate faster as we try to fix and improve it in this way or do our actions themselves simply not lead to any good?

Let’s say we help Africa and by this, according to statistics, hunger and unemployment increases there, and the number of people who no longer think about anything but sit, do nothing, and live on welfare increases.

First of all, man is satisfied with little and does not want to develop. Second, these seemingly good deeds actually spoil us. Because we are selfish! By developing such systems of public assistance, we actually are killing the desire to improve, the desire to act, in people.

Man Feels Good When The Whole Universe Feels Good

744Question: Man understands what is good based on what it is good for him. How can we understand what is good based on the global law of the universe?

Answer: People can feel good only when the whole universe feels good because everything is one single organism. Even cosmologists and people who deal with global nature around us talk about this.

The academic Vernadsky came to his theory of noosphere in this way. Famous philosophers and physicists who have studied the universe, including Einstein, write that the whole universe is a huge, enclosed, multi-layered, composite, infinite thought in which all parts are interconnected and support each other.

It is a huge, perfect organism that includes absolutely everything. And we are a cancerous tumor in it because we think only about ourselves. This is the property of cancer. When a part of the body begins to think about itself and absorbs everything into itself, this disease appears.

When There Is No Support Of The Society

559Question: How can you raise a person to be simply good? At school, they tried to instill ethics and morality in us, but we can see that this does not work.

Answer: Our social and educational systems do not work because they do not have the support of society. As society becomes more open, people move further away from each other. Let’s take the very vivid example of China. It was a closed society that lived according to its own laws, different from the whole world.

Now that Chinese society is opening, it is starting to spread. There is no connection. No matter how much they try, they cannot stay together for long. Even more so, it is such a diverse, multifaceted set of people.

You cannot associate yourself with a huge number of people who are so different, incomprehensible, and inconceivable to your feelings. When it is millions, it is impossible.
